1. Understand Your Debt Situation
Before tackling debt, it’s essential to have a clear understanding of what you owe. Here’s how:
- List All Debts: Create a comprehensive list that includes credit cards, personal loans, student loans, car loans, and any other financial obligations.
- Note Interest Rates: Identify the interest rates for each debt. High-interest debts, like credit cards, should be prioritized due to the rapid accumulation of interest.
- Analyze Minimum Payments: Know the minimum monthly payment required for each debt. This ensures you stay current on obligations while planning repayments.
2. Prioritize Debt Repayment with Effective Methods
There are two popular strategies for paying off debts:
a. The Debt Snowball Method
- Focus on paying off the smallest debts first while making minimum payments on larger ones.
- Once a small debt is paid off, roll the freed-up funds into the next smallest debt.
